A Roblox clothing stealer is a tool—often a browser extension, Python script, or third-party website—designed to download the texture templates of shirts and pants created by others. These stolen assets are then frequently re-uploaded and sold by the thieves, violating the original creator's intellectual property.

Many "free" clothing stealing tools are actually scams designed to steal login credentials, particularly the robo.security key. This allows hackers to gain access to accounts without a password or two-step verification. Roblox Clothing Stealer

: Roblox's moderation team uses automated filters to detect duplicate clothing. Accounts caught "stealing" or "copying" can be permanently banned.

Original creators can submit a formal Intellectual Property rights notification to Roblox to have stolen copies of their work permanently removed.

A "Roblox Clothing Stealer" is a general term for tools, scripts, browser extensions, or websites designed to copy or download the template—the flat image file—of clothing items created by other users.

The Avatar Shop is frequently plagued by spam. Search results for specific terms are often flooded with hundreds of identical, stolen clothing items uploaded by bot accounts. This algorithmic noise makes it incredibly difficult for users to discover original content and authentic creators. Group Terminations and Bans
